Access Relation Plusieurs À Plusieurs Du
Il n'est pas possible d'ajouter une autre ligne avec les valeurs 1012 et 30, car la combinaison de la référence de la commande et de la référence de produit forme la clé primaire et que les clés primaires doivent être uniques. Au lieu de cela, nous ajoutons un champ Quantité à la table Détails de la commande. Quantité 1 5 Créer une table intermédiaire Sélectionnez Créer > Table. Sélectionnez Enregistrer. Pour Nom de la table, entrez un titre descriptif. Pour préciser sa fonction, vous pouvez inclure la mention jointure ou intermédiaire dans le nom de la table. Créer des champs dans la table intermédiaire Access ajoute automatiquement un champ Réf à la première colonne de la table. Access relation plusieurs à plusieurs maroc. Modifiez ce champ de manière à reproduire la référence de la première table dans votre relation plusieurs-à-plusieurs. Par exemple, si la première table est une table Commandes appelée Réf commande et que sa clé primaire est un nombre, remplacez le nom du champ Réf dans la nouvelle table par Réf commande et, pour le type de données, utilisez Numérique.
- Access relation plusieurs à plusieurs artistes
- Access relation plusieurs à plusieurs milliers
- Access relation plusieurs à plusieurs part
- Access relation plusieurs à plusieurs années
- Access relation plusieurs à plusieurs avec
Access Relation Plusieurs À Plusieurs Artistes
J'encode via un formulaire donc je cherche un moyen qui forcerait a encoder quand meme un enregistrement Ecrit. Ou du moins afficher le sous formulaire pour pas l'oublier... 18/06/2006, 03h53 #7 Mais bien sûr un livre doit être écrit par au moins 1 auteur parceque alors un livre peut toujours exister sans auteur! C'est pas très clair JM 18/06/2006, 12h28 #8 Envoyé par OtObOx C'est pas moi qui le veut justement mais c'est la relation access qui l'autorise. Etant donnée que dans livre il n'y a pas de clé étrangère, un livre peut exister sans relation avec la table écrit, par contre si je met une clé étrangère (idauteur ou id écrit pareil dans ce cas) dans la table livre alors je suis limité à UNE relation donc un auteur. Il va falloir faire un code a l'encodage pour forcer ca ou du moins afficher un sous formulaire sur sortie de l'enregistrement d'un livre. PS. Access relation plusieurs à plusieurs années. merci quand même de votre interet à mon problème 18/06/2006, 14h43 #9 Peut être devrais tu revoir l'organisation de tes tables? Ta table "ecrit" est-elle vraiment obligatoire pour la suite de ce que tu veux faire?
Access Relation Plusieurs À Plusieurs Milliers
18/02/2007, 14h35 #1 Membre du Club relation plusieurs à plusieurs comment puis créer une relation plusieur à plusieur dans une base de donnée accèss 18/02/2007, 15h42 #2 bonjour Je pense que tu devrais trouver cela dans la faq 18/02/2007, 16h54 #3 Bonjour Nacera, Si vous ne trouvez pas dans la Faq, n'oubliez pas l'Aide d'Access. Relation plusieurs à plusieurs - Access. Voici déjà un exemple de ce qui est dit: Définir une relation plusieurs-à-plusieurs Créez les tables entre lesquelles vous souhaitez établir une relation plusieurs-à-plusieurs. (relation plusieurs à plusieurs: association entre deux tables dans laquelle un enregistrement de l'une des tables peut être lié à plusieurs enregistrements de l'autre table. Pour établir une relation de ce type, créez une troisième table, puis ajoutez à cette table les champs de clé primaire des deux autres tables. ) Créez une troisième table, appelée table de jonction, puis ajoutez-lui de nouveaux champs possédant les mêmes définitions que les champs de clé primaire de chacune des deux autres tables.
Access Relation Plusieurs À Plusieurs Part
Rappelez-vous qu'il a été dit plus haut que « la clef primaire de la table 3 est au minimum la combinaison des 2 autres clefs ». Au minimum. Si on poursuit ce raisonnement, vous risquez parfois d'avoir une clef primaire composée de plein de champs, ce qui peut être lourd à gérer. Vous pouvez alors la remplacer par une clef primaire mono-champ (le champ étant de type NuméroAuto). Access relation plusieurs à plusieurs plus. Mais il serait bon que la combinaison des autres champs reste indexée sans doublons. Étiquettes: table Vous aimerez aussi...
Access Relation Plusieurs À Plusieurs Années
La grande majorité de vos relations sera probablement celle-ci avec de nombreuses relations où un enregistrement d'une table a le potentiel d'être lié à de nombreux enregistrements d'une autre table. Le processus pour créer une relation un-à-plusieurs est exactement le même que pour créer une relation un-à-un. Commençons par effacer la mise en page en cliquant sur le Clear Layout option sur le Design tab. Nous allons d'abord ajouter une autre table tblTasks comme indiqué dans la capture d'écran suivante. Clique sur le Save icône et entrez tblTasks comme nom de table et accédez au Relationship vue. Clique sur le Show Table option. Ajouter tblProjects et tblTasks et fermez le Show Table boite de dialogue. Nous pouvons recommencer le même processus pour relier ces tableaux. Relation Plusieurs à Plusieurs (n:n) - Le Grenier Access. Cliquez et maintenez ProjectID à partir de tblProjects et faites-le glisser jusqu'à ProjectID à partir de tblTasks. De plus, une fenêtre de relations apparaît lorsque vous relâchez la souris. Cliquez sur le bouton Créer.
Access Relation Plusieurs À Plusieurs Avec
Liste de choix du candidat ▲ Elle est liée au champ IdCandidat de la table et permet de choisir un candidat inscrit à l'examen. Liste de choix cmbCandidat Elle a comme contenu la requête R_Candidats et affiche les noms complets des candidats, leur identifiant étant masqué: colonne n°1: elle est masquée et liée au champ IdCandidat; colonne n°2: affiche les noms complets des inscrits. Cette astuce permet d'afficher dans la liste le nom du candidat au lieu de son identifiant et d'alimenter en réalité la colonne IdCandidat de la table intermédiaire. VIII. Formulaire principal ▲ Il est basé sur la table T_Examen et contient les contrôles liés aux champs de cette table. Il comprend en plus le sous-formulaire permettant de choisir les inscrits. Relation plusieurs-à-plusieurs dans Access. Fomulaire principal en mode création VIII-A. Liaison entre le formulaire principal et le sous-formulaire ▲ Pour les relier, on définit dans les propriétés du contrôle sous-formulaire, la colonne IdExamen de la table T_Examen comme champ père, et la colonne IdExamen de la table T_Inscription_Examen comme champ fils.
Droits de diffusion permanents accordés à Developpez LLC.